我目前使用PDF轉Flash來允許用戶翻轉上傳的PDF文件。然而,有這麼多人使用iPhone/iPad,我希望將其切換成適用於任何瀏覽器的解決方案。轉換PDF以便在任何瀏覽器中查看
該網站是在Ruby on Rails中開發的,我研究過使用pdf-toolkit和rmagick將PDF轉換爲圖像,但這還不夠,因爲我希望頁面與瀏覽器窗口一起縮放 - SVG不是一個選項因爲我需要它工作瓦特/ IE6;)
任何想法?
THX,
摹
我目前使用PDF轉Flash來允許用戶翻轉上傳的PDF文件。然而,有這麼多人使用iPhone/iPad,我希望將其切換成適用於任何瀏覽器的解決方案。轉換PDF以便在任何瀏覽器中查看
該網站是在Ruby on Rails中開發的,我研究過使用pdf-toolkit和rmagick將PDF轉換爲圖像,但這還不夠,因爲我希望頁面與瀏覽器窗口一起縮放 - SVG不是一個選項因爲我需要它工作瓦特/ IE6;)
任何想法?
THX,
摹
你爲什麼不使用http://docs.google.com/viewer?
http://googlesystem.blogspot.com/2009/09/embeddable-google-document-viewer.html
這真的很簡單,它是沒有閃光燈(可滿足iPhone用戶也:d)。只需將其添加到視圖中即可:
<iframe src="http://docs.google.com/viewer?url=#{YOUR_PDF_URL}&embedded=true"
style="width:600px; height:500px;" frameborder="0"></iframe>
另一種選擇是類似Zmags的數字發佈平臺。它將PDF轉換爲Flash,但在移動設備上查看時,它會轉換爲可滑動的版本。負載也很快。
謝謝。我考慮過要麼: 1.轉換爲SVG(適用於webkit和firefox瀏覽器)和SWF(適用於IE等)並相應顯示。 2.轉換爲SVG和VML(用於在IE中顯示)。 3.使用javascript動態調整PNG/JPG的大小,以查看視口的大小。 這些選項的任何反饋? – Gustav 2010-08-14 09:29:13